Biography

Nico Segal is a trumpeter, composer, and producer whose genre-defying career has made him a standout voice in modern music. Born and raised in Chicago, Segal emerged as a founding member of the GRAMMY-winning collective The Social Experiment, where he co-created groundbreaking projects like Surf (2015) under the moniker Donnie Trumpet and contributed to Chance the Rapper’s Coloring Book. In addition to his collaborative achievements, Segal is a co-creator of Intellexual, an introspective duo project with longtime collaborator Nate Fox. Intellexual blends art pop, jazz, and cinematic influences, further demonstrating Segal’s penchant for innovation and sonic exploration. Segal is also a founding member of The JuJu Exchange, a jazz-forward ensemble that merges improvisation with elements of hip-hop and electronic music. With The JuJu Exchange, Segal has continued to redefine what modern jazz can be, crafting compositions that speak to both the head and the heart. Whether leading his own projects or lending his trumpet and production to artists like Kanye West and Vic Mensa, Segal’s work is defined by its emotional depth and boundary-pushing creativity. His career reflects a commitment to building bridges between musical worlds, solidifying his reputation as a versatile and visionary artist.
